Basics

The first driving lesson is about getting comfortable and learning the basics. This includes familiarising yourself with the controls, pedals, and the overall feel and size of your vehicle. It is essential that the first lesson is done in a safe environment because it's a shame to make a mistake on a busy road.

The instructor will then ask the student to get into the vehicle and then start the engine. They will then drive to a peaceful road or Learn Driving Lessons car park, where they will practice the fundamentals of driving the car, including setting the seat and mirrors in the position they prefer and practicing how to operate the handbrake and gears.

In the initial few classes the instructor will aid the student in developing clutch control and finding the transmission's biting point. They will also practice steering and moving the vehicle forward and backward at low speeds.

At the beginning of the driving experience, it is important that the instructor goes through the process slow and teaches the driver to be patient. It is also important that the student isn't allowed to make too many mistakes on their own as this will only create anxiety and Learn Driving Lessons possibly lead to frustration.

After the student has mastered basic driving skills, instructors will teach more difficult situations like parking in tight spaces or on hills that are steep. Instructors will teach students to observe their surroundings by regularly checking mirrors and using turn signals. This allows drivers to examine their surroundings and decide if it's the right time to change direction.

Mirrors

While it is important to keep your eyes on the road ahead, this can result in you missing out on valuable information in your mirrors. Your instructor will teach you to use the mirrors in your car to ensure that you can see what's going on around you.

In your car, there will have three mirrors: the center mirror, or the main mirror, and two side (nearside, passenger side, and offside) mirrors. Checking your mirrors regularly is essential to make sure you are making use of them efficiently, particularly when merging or changing lanes.

You will also learn how to adjust your mirrors. This will enable you to see the entire image of your car and the other vehicles that are in it. This is vital, especially when driving on roads such as dual carriageways or motorways that typically have national speed limits.

Your instructor will require you to check the mirrors after you have them set up correctly. This means making them adjustable so that you see the entire image of your car in the rear view mirror. This includes any passengers or objects in your vehicle. It is best to do this while you're parked as vehicle vibrations can alter the adjustment of the mirror.

Once you've completed this and your instructor has asked you to drive and then examine the mirrors regularly. This may initially be a conscious decision on your part, but over time it will become routine. Alongside checking your mirrors, you should be looking at the road around you for anything that could interfere with your driving. This could include vehicles that are approaching cyclists, pedestrians, or other vehicles.
